  • Portion of 6th Street between Grand Avenue and Hope Street

    Portion of 6th Street between Grand Avenue and Hope Street

    Visual Materials

    Side view of the University Club building seen from 6th Street. University Club of Los Angeles was founded March 27, 1898. Short building to the left with the terra cotta tile roof at 614 West 6th Street was designed by John Parkinson; Morris Carr, men's clothier and custom tailor business, occupies it.

  • 5th Street between Flower Street and Grand Avenue

    5th Street between Flower Street and Grand Avenue

    Visual Materials

    From the roof of the Jonathan Club looking east across Flower Street towards Los Angeles Central Library. Steel skyscraper, 515 South Flower Street, of City National Plaza (formerly ARCO Plaza) taking shape at left. From left to right across the street from the library are the Sunkist Building, parking garage, Engstrum Apartment Hotel and the Edison Building. Pacific Bell Tower is in the center background.
